Dr. Nobita Chatterjee, MD is an internist in Newton Center, MA and has over 30 years of experience in the medical field. She graduated from CALCUTTA UNIVERSITY / VIVEKANANDA INSTITUTE OF MEDICAL SCIENCES in 1992. She is affiliated with Beth Israel Deaconess Hospital-Needham. She is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.

Nobita Chatterjee
This doctor saved my wife's life. During a routine health exam, she detected (heard) an anomaly while listening to her heart. She recommended and set up a follow-up visit with a heart specialist and they confirmed an aneurysm that required immediate surgery. My wife recovered completely and is back to hiking in the mountains. Dr Chatterjee listens to what you have to say, recommends what she thinks is best, and respects your wishes with respect to your health. With me, she has always been very professional and caring.
